Biological Background: METTL4 Function and Localization

  • METTL4 (methyltransferase-like protein 4) is an N(6)-adenine-specific methyltransferase capable of modifying both RNA and DNA molecules. Related references: PMID:31913360, PMID:32183942

  • It catalyzes formation of N6,2'-O-dimethyladenosine (m6A(m)) on internal positions of U2 small nuclear RNA (snRNA), a modification that regulates pre-mRNA splicing. Related references: PMID:31913360

  • METTL4 also functions as a DNA N(6)-adenine methyltransferase, although the biological role of m6A on mammalian DNA remains under investigation and requires further confirmation. Related references: PMID:32183942, PMID:32203414

  • In the mitochondrial matrix, METTL4 methylates mitochondrial DNA (mtDNA), repressing transcription by inhibiting TFAM binding and DNA bending, thereby influencing mtDNA copy number and mitochondrial gene expression. Related references: PMID:32183942

  • The enzyme contributes to Polycomb silencing by promoting ubiquitination and degradation of ASXL1 and MPND, leading to inactivation of the PR-DUB complex (By similarity).

  • Subcellularly, METTL4 localizes to the nucleus, cytosol, and mitochondrial matrix, reflecting its involvement in both nuclear and mitochondrial nucleic acid methylation.

  • As a member of the methyltransferase family, it uses S-adenosyl-L-methionine as a methyl donor and is implicated in chromatin regulation.

Experimental Guidance and Technical Tips

  • Immunogen design: The antibody was raised against a recombinant protein encompassing the N-terminal region (aa 1–190) of human METTL4, a segment that shows conservation across human, mouse, and rat, supporting cross-reactivity.
  • Western blotting: In WB, a band near 54 kDa is anticipated; use mitochondrial-enriched or whole-cell lysates and titrate the antibody for optimal signal-to-noise.
  • IHC-P / IF-ICC: For staining, we suggest antigen retrieval and permeabilization steps, and validation in METTL4-expressing tissues or cell lines.
  • ELISA: This antibody can be employed in sandwich or direct ELISA formats; include appropriate recombinant protein standards for quantification.
  • Cross-reactivity: While reactivity with human, mouse, and rat is reported, end-users should verify performance in their specific sample type and species.
